Dill Pickle Pasta Salad

Dill Pickle Pasta Salad: Only 1 Bowl Needed for Pure Joy

  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ings

Description

A creamy, tangy pasta salad featuring the bright, briny flavor of dill pickles.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ound elbow macaroni
  • 1 cup mayonnaise
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• 1/4 cup pickle juice
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h dill
  • 1/4 cup chopped red onion
  • 2 cups chopped dill pickles
  • Salt and black pepper to taste


Instructions

  1. Cook the elbow macaroni according to package directions. Drain and rinse with cold water.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, sour cream, and pickle juice.
  3. Add the cooked pasta, chopped dill, chopped red onion, and chopped dill pickles to the bowl.
  4. Toss everything together until well combined.
  5. Season with salt and black pepper to taste.
  6. Chill the pasta salad for at least 30 minutes before serving.

Notes

  • For a tangier salad, add more pickle juice.
  • You can use other pasta shapes like rotini or shells.
  • Add cooked chicken or ham for a heartier salad.
